Abstract
This patent is related to separation of solid and liquid field, specifically disclose a kind of filtering filter press of air compression type, this filter to mixed liquor before filtering, pre- separation first has been carried out to the impurity in mixed liquor with partition, reduce the amount of impurity in the mixed liquor of upper strata, and then the possibility that filter bores are blocked by impurity is reduced, improve the efficiency of filtering;Air pressure mechanism is utilized simultaneously, steady quickly extruding is carried out to the air in filter chamber, mixed liquor is uniformly extruded, makes mixed liquor by the filtering of fast and stable, the impurity in mixed liquor keeps geo-stationary simultaneously, can further reduce the probability that filter bores are blocked.This programme can prevent that filter bores from being blocked, and then improve the efficiency of filtering.
Description
Technical field
The invention belongs to separation of solid and liquid field, and in particular to a kind of filtering filter press of air compression type.
Background technology
Now current organic agricultural chemicals is that, by a series of organic reaction, will be needed during artificial synthesized agricultural chemicals
Raw material that some are easy to get, cheap is used to be prepared into the process of new, complex, more valuable organic compound.
Raw material easily obtain, cheap mostly inorganic pesticide, such as lime, sulphur.Inorganic pesticide is being synthesized to the mistake of organic agricultural chemicals
Cheng Zhong, can be first by raw material formation filtrate soluble in water, and the filtrate of formation is easy to react to form organic agriculture with other raw materials of later stage
Medicine.
Contain many impurity in the raw materials such as lime, sulphur, and most of impurity is all unwanted, so needing to it
In impurity filtered.When with conventional filter in filtering, what most of mixed liquor flowed from top to bottom, impurity meeting
Coordinate always with the filter opening in device, after prolonged use, impurity can be deposited at the filter opening of device, cause the envelope of filter opening
It is stifled;And in filter process, impurity meeting covering part filter opening causes the quantity of filter opening to reduce, can greatly reduce the effect of filtering
Rate.
The content of the invention
The invention is intended to provide a kind of filtering filter press of air compression type, to avoid filter bores from being blocked, and then improve
The efficiency of filtering.
In order to achieve the above object, base case of the invention is as follows:A kind of filtering filter press of air compression type, including
Accommodating chamber is provided with casing, the casing, and the upper end of casing is communicated with the feed hopper of accommodating chamber, and be provided with feed hopper close
Capping;Also include partition, air pressure mechanism and filter mechanism;
The partition includes from top to bottom horizontally disposed baffle plate and demarcation strip, and the demarcation strip is fixedly mounted on casing
In accommodating chamber, demarcation strip divides the accommodating chamber of casing filter chamber and indwelling chamber from top to bottom, and the side wall of indwelling chamber is provided with
Collection port;The demarcation strip is provided with first through hole;Slided through the side of casing and the surface of demarcation strip one end of the baffle plate
Move and coordinate, and baffle plate is slidingly sealed with casing;
The air pressure mechanism includes atmospheric pressure board, handle and the bellows that is vertically arranged, the surrounding of the atmospheric pressure board and casing it is interior
Wall is slidably matched, and the handle is fixedly mounted on the upper surface of atmospheric pressure board;The second through hole, institute are vertically arranged with the atmospheric pressure board
The lower end of bellows is stated to be fixedly connected with the second through hole of atmospheric pressure board;
The filter mechanism includes some horizontally disposed outlet pipes and some screen pipes being vertically arranged, and the outlet pipe is fixed
Installed in the top of filter chamber, upper end and the outlet pipe of screen pipe are detachably connected;The lower end of the screen pipe sequentially passes through ripple
In line pipe and the second through hole insertion filter chamber, and the second through hole of screen pipe and atmospheric pressure board is slidably connected, the upper end of bellows
It is fixedly connected with outlet pipe;The lower end of the screen pipe is provided with some filter bores.
The principle of base case:1st, original state, first opens closure, pulls handle, atmospheric pressure board is located at filter chamber
Topmost, now bellows is in compressive state, then pulls baffle plate, is fully opened the first through hole on demarcation strip.
2nd, mixed liquor is poured at feed hopper, makes height of the liquid level higher than the filter bores of top of mixed liquor;
Then whole filter press is stood 5-10 minutes, now substantial amounts of impurity is deposited in indwelling chamber in mixed liquor, is then pushed away again
Dynamic baffle plate, is made the first through hole on demarcation strip be blocked completely, is then sealed feed hopper using closure.
3rd, handle is pushed down on, drives atmospheric pressure board to move down, while the air extruded in filter chamber is moved down, makes to mix
Close liquid to be extruded into the filter bores of screen pipe, the impurity remained in mixed liquor is blocked in outside screen pipe;Filtrate after filtering
Outlet pipe is entered by screen pipe, filtrate, which is held in outlet pipe, to be discharged, and collects the filtrate discharged from outlet pipe.
4th, in above filter process, atmospheric pressure board continuous decrease, after the second through hole passes through filter bores, the level of filter opening
Highly it is higher than the upper surface of atmospheric pressure board, now bellows stops to the filtrate for filtering Bottomhole pressure, makes the filter in screen pipe
Liquid is flowed out by outlet pipe, is easy to be collected the filtrate after filtering.
5th, last slide damper, makes indwelling chamber be connected with filter chamber, then opens collection port, collects the impurity of indwelling intracavitary
With mixed liquor.
The advantage of base case:When the 1st, filtering, atmospheric pressure board can be slided in filter chamber, and the air in filter chamber is carried out
Extruding, the pressure that air is formed after being extruded is uniform, the mixed liquor uniform force allowed in filter chamber, and then is allowed after sedimentation
Impurity keeps geo-stationary in mixed liquor, reduces the possibility of impurity and the contact of filter opening, and then effectively reduces filter bores quilt
The possibility of blocking, can effectively improve the efficiency of filtering;2nd, demarcation strip and baffle plate are provided with accommodating chamber, baffle plate and demarcation strip can be by
Impurity barrier after sedimentation is in indwelling intracavitary, and the convenient impurity to bulky grain is tentatively filtered;It is simultaneously convenient in mixed liquor
Impurity be collected;3rd, bellows can be compressed or be stretched during atmospheric pressure board is moved, while when bellows movement
When to filter bores, the liquid flowed in filter bores can be blocked, facilitate filtrate to be flowed after screen pipe out of outlet pipe
Go out;4th, after the liquid level reduction of mixed liquor, the filter bores close to screen pipe upper end are separated with mixed liquor at first, and concentrate on filtering
The filter bores of pipe lower end are also more, and the velocity variations of mixed liquor filtering are not obvious, to ensure the fast rate of filtration.
In summary, this filter to mixed liquor before filtering, first with partition to the impurity in mixed liquor
Pre- separation has been carried out, the amount of impurity in the mixed liquor of upper strata is reduced, and then has reduced the possibility that filter bores are blocked by impurity, had been improved
The efficiency of filter;Simultaneously using air pressure mechanism, steady quickly extruding is carried out to the air in filter chamber, makes mixed liquor by uniform
Extruding, make mixed liquor by the filtering of fast and stable, while impurity in mixed liquor keeps geo-stationary, can further reduce
The probability that filter bores are blocked.
